Looking for Bankruptcy Lawyers in Turlock?

Bankruptcy lawyers help individuals and businesses find relief from overwhelming debt. They analyze your financial situation and guide you through processes like Chapter 7 liquidation or Chapter 13 reorganization. Their goal is to stop creditor harassment, protect your assets, and provide a legal path to a fresh financial start.

What are the requirements to file chapter 13 bankruptcy?

default-avatar
Answered by attorney Gregory J Wald (Unclaimed Profile)
Bankruptcy lawyer at Gregory J. Wald
You must be an individual or married couple with a regular source of income that is sufficient to meet your living expenses and make a debt consolidation payment. In order to receive a discharge in the Chapter 13 case, you cannot have received a discharge in a Chapter 7 case filed within the past four years or a previous Chapter 13 filed within the past two years.

Is it legal to continue billing me for mortgage if I included it in chapter 7?

default-avatar
Answered by attorney Jason Thomas Olivier (Unclaimed Profile)
Bankruptcy lawyer at Olivier Law Firm, LLC
Once you are discharged, you do not owe the mortgage. The mortgage remains on the property however. Anyone can ask you for money, but you are not legally bound to pay them. Same case here, though I would have an attorney send them a cease and desist letter.
